Stayton, Oregon
263 E Ida St, Stayton, OR 97383, United States
Stayton, OR
Let The Hub know you'd love to order ahead for pickup!
Claim your listing to update info, add photos, and access joe's tools for coffee shops.
We'll tell The Hub that you want to order ahead.
Verify your ownership of The Hub and get access to joe's tools.